About Qihui Sun

Qihui Sun is a scholar working on Molecular Biology, Pharmacology, Epidemiology, Complementary and alternative medicine and Plant Science, having authored 33 papers that have together received 419 indexed citations. Recurring topics across this work include Pharmacological Effects of Natural Compounds (4 papers), Chromatography in Natural Products (3 papers), Metabolomics and Mass Spectrometry Studies (2 papers), Phytochemistry and biological activity of medicinal plants (2 papers), Lignin and Wood Chemistry (2 papers), Plant-based Medicinal Research (2 papers), Ferroptosis and cancer prognosis (2 papers) and FOXO transcription factor regulation (2 papers). The work is most often cited by research in Complementary and alternative medicine (67 citations), Pharmacology (32 citations), Immunology (42 citations), Hematology (21 citations) and Biological Psychiatry (4 citations). Qihui Sun has collaborated with scholars based in China, United States and Macao. Frequent co-authors include Xiaohong Li, Jibiao Wu, Jianhua Zhen, Rong Rong, Xu Wang, Jun Li, Guodong Liang, Yin Zongyi, Yang Liu and Kangjun Wu. Their work appears in journals such as Journal of Ethnopharmacology, Journal of Chromatography A, BioResources, Frontiers in Pharmacology and Frontiers in Cellular and Infection Microbiology.
